Solution: 19 to the Power of 27 is equal to 3.3600614943460446e+34

Step-by-step: finding 19 to the power of 27
The first step is to understand what it means when a number has an exponent. The βpowerβ of a number indicates how many times the base would be multiplied by itself to reach the correct value.
The second step is to write the number in the base-exponent form, and lastly calculate what the final result would be. Consider the example of 2 to the power of 4: in exponent form that would be

To simplify this, all that is needed is to multiply it out:
19 x 19 x 19 x 19 x ... (for a total of 27 times) = 3.3600614943460446e+34
Therefore, 19 to the power of 27 is 3.3600614943460446e+34.
